Tech and Security: What Powers the Aviator Game?
The integrity of the aviator game experience hinges on robust technology and trustworthy randomization. Leading providers like Spribe employ cryptographically secure random number generators (RNGs) to ensure fairness, a necessary feature given the real-money stakes involved. These systems are regularly audited by regulatory bodies in jurisdictions that oversee online gaming, contributing to player confidence.
